Salary at this grade

Basic monthly salary at AST4 runs from €5,438 (step 1) to €6,153 (top step), giving an annual range of roughly €65,256 to €73,836 before tax and allowances. Steps increase automatically every two years; the figures here are taken from the salary grid in the EU Staff Regulations.

Eligible staff posted away from their country of nationality also receive an expatriation allowance worth 16% of basic salary (around €870 per month at step 1 of AST4) together with household, dependent-child, and education allowances where applicable. Net pay at this grade

At step 1 of AST4, gross monthly basic salary on the Assistants grid is €5,438. Eligible expatriate staff add a 16% expatriation allowance on top (roughly €870 per month) before two automatic deductions reduce the taxable base: the joint sickness insurance scheme (JSIS, ~3.6%, €227) and the EU pension contribution (~10.3%, €650). EU community tax (Council Reg. 260/68) is then applied progressively; for the AD7-equivalent band the effective rate sits in the 11 to 13% range, which works out to about €652 per month here.
Athens carries a correction coefficient of 86.6% (Article 64 of the Staff Regulations), so the net is multiplied by 0.87 to reflect the local cost of living. On those assumptions take-home pay is approximately €4,139 per month, or about €49,668 per year, before household and dependent-child allowances, which can add several hundred euros monthly for staff with families. Career trajectory

Career progression for AST4 staff is governed by Articles 44 to 46 of the Staff Regulations (consolidated text on EUR-Lex) and Annex IB on the promotion procedure. Step increases are automatic every two years (Art. 44); grade promotion is competitive, based on the appraisal exercise (Art. 45) and the Career Development Review. For roles at ENISA, AST grades progress one level every three to five years on merit; AD reclassification via a CAST or internal competition is the longer-term route. Article 46 governs the classification at recruitment, which sets the starting step within the grade (usually step 1 for external recruits without prior EU service, step 2 or 3 where relevant professional experience is recognised).
Mobility within the institutions is encouraged via the inter-institutional and intra-institutional vacancy publication system: temporary agents who pass the probation period and reservists from EPSO laureate lists can typically apply to internal vacancies after one year of service.
